How Our Team Performs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ration

Our process is designed to get you back to normal as soon as possible. We start by assessing the damage and determining the best course of action. Our team will then use specialized equipment to remove any standing water, dry out the affected area, and repair or replace any damaged tile or flooring.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ll assess the damage and contain any water to prevent further damage.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 2: Water Removal

We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any standing water from your tile floor. This step usually takes 1-2 hours, depending on the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ry out your tile floor and prevent further damage from water vapor. This step can take anywhere from 2-5 days, depending on the humidity level in your home.

Step 4: Repair and Replacement

Once your tile floor is dry, we’ll repair or replace any damaged tile or flooring. This step usually takes 1-3 days, depending on the extent of the dam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your tile floor is completely dry and damage-free. We’ll also cl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ent any further damage or health risks.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Winding Cypress, FL

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Winding Cypress, FL.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for our services.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$100 – $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Water Removal $500 – $2,000 Amount of water present and type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Humidity level in your home and length of drying time
Repair and Replacement $500 – $2,500 Extent of damage and type of materials needed
Final Inspection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Complexity of the job and materials needed

Common Questions About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ration

Q: How long does the restoration process take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ete the restoration process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. On average, it can take anywhere from 2-5 days to complete the job.

Q: Will I need to pay for any more services?

A: No, our prices are inclusive of all services needed to complete the job. We’ll provide you with a detailed estimate and ensure you’re aware of any more costs before we begin work.

Q: Will I need to replace my entire tile floor?

A: Not necessarily. If the damage is contained to a small area, we may be able to repair or replace only the affected section of tile. But, if the damage is extensive, it may be more cost-effective to replace the entire floor.

Q: Can I still use my tile floor after the restoration process is complete?

A: Yes, your tile floor should be safe to use after the restoration process is complete. But, it’s essential to follow our instructions for drying and cleaning your tile floor to prevent any further damage or health risks.

Q: How do I prevent water damage from occurring in the first place?

A: To prevent water damage, make sure to inspect your pipes and appliances regularly, fix any leaks quickly, and keep an eye out for any signs of water damage, such as warping or buckling tile.
